操作系统实验,实验3, 进程管理 (1)概述 实验三Linux进程管理 Linux进程概述 Linux是一个多用户、多任务的操作系统各种计算机资源(如文件、内存、CPU等)的分配和管理都以进程为单位为了协调多个进程对这些共享资源的访问,操作系统要跟踪所有进程的活动,以及它们对系统资源的使用情况,从而实施对进程和资源的动态管理 ...
操作系统实验,实验3, 进程管理 (1)实验三Linux进程管理 Linux进程概述 Linux是一个多用户、多任务的操作系统 各种计算机资源(如文件、内存、CPU等)的分配和管理都以进程为单位为了协调多个进程对这些共享资源的访问,操作系统要跟踪所有进程的活动,以及它们对系统资源的使用情况,从而实施对进程和资源的...
《操作系统原理及应用》实验指导书21 实验二 进程管理 进程的控制实验实验目的 1、掌握进程另外的创建方法 2、熟悉进程的睡眠、同步、撤消等进程控制方法 实验内容 1、用fork 创建一个进程 再调用exec 用新的程序替换该子进程的内容 2、利用wait 来控制进程执行顺序 实验指导 一、所涉及的系统调用 在UNIX LINUX中...
那么CPU就会出现如下情况: 此时CPU利用率为50% 而更普遍来说,计算指令一般为30-50条指令,此时CPU利用率为0 多道程序,交替执行是管理CPU的核心 schedule()函数非常重要 getNext()函数的作用是调度 这段代码必须用汇编写 内存管理其实也是为多进程图像服务的 参考实验报告: https://www.shiyanlou.com/courses/repor...